Modelling supply-demand mismatches in ecosystem services for urban heat island mitigation and heat vulnerability
Abstract:
Land surface temperatures tend to be higher in densely built urban areas compared to suburban-rural borders, creating urban heat islands (UHIs) which have become one of the main environmental hazards for city dwellers. Impacts range from heat mortality, air quality degradation and exacerbated heat stress on biodiversity and ecosystems. However, due to the heterogeneous nature of urban landscapes and socio-spatial inequities driving landscape attributes like impervious surfaces and vegetation cover, UHI burdens are not evenly distributed. To mitigate UHIs, urban green infrastructure (UGI) can provide critical ecosystem services. Therefore, to understand the relationship between users' access and dependence on these benefits, we propose an approach integrating remote sensing, field and socio-demographic data with Artificial Intelligence for Environment and Sustainability (ARIES) and GIS tools. This approach includes: i) indicators of UHI exposure and urban heat vulnerability indices; ii) spatial quantification of the supply and demand of UGBS related to ecosystem services for UHI mitigation; iii) spatially explicit (mis)matches of ecosystem services supply and demand balance; iv) coupled modelling; and v) considerations for management and decision-making. In this presentation, we will focus on the progress made in these components, along with preliminary results.

Troubling the transformative potentials of Urban Climate Experiments: A Socio-Political and Justice-Oriented lens
Abstract:
In the midst of looming socio-ecological emergencies, not least the climate change challenge, urban climate experiments emerge as dominant tools for stirring more sustainable and, potentially, just urban transformations. Urban living labs, test-beds solutions, pilot projects, or bottom-up innovations in diverse urban planning fields have been proliferating across localities, engendering a veritable “experimental turn” in urban climate governance and planning. Yet, what emerges from the vast debate on experimentation is that the capacity of experiments to be radically transformative and to foster greater justice should not be taken for granted.
This presentation aims at conceptualizing and critically reflecting upon the transformative potentials of urban climate experiments. The conceptual lens of “governance tensions” will be mobilized to account for an actor-oriented view on potentials and struggles to effect change and to account for greater justice. While the presentation will be mostly conceptual and reflective, empirical insights from experiments in Italy - specifically in the context of Turin - will be provided.
